How much do independent contractor work from home structural bim modeler j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for independent contractor work from home structural bim modeler in the United States is $40.33,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$31.25 and $43.51 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an independent contractor work from home structural BIM modeler do?

An Independent Contractor Work From Home Structural BIM Modeler creates detailed digital models of building structures using Building Information Modeling (BIM) software, such as Revit or Tekla. Working remotely, they collaborate with architects, engineers, and other construction professionals to produce accurate representations of a project's structural elements. Their responsibilities include interpreting structural drawings, ensuring models meet project specifications, and coordinating with team members to resolve design issues. As independent contractors, they typically manage their own schedules and client communications.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an independent contractor work from home structural BIM modeler?

To thrive as an Independent Contractor Work From Home Structural BIM Modeler, you need a strong understanding of structural engineering concepts, proficiency in Building Information Modeling (BIM), and a relevant degree or certification in civil or structural engineering. Expertise with software like Autodesk Revit, Navisworks, and AutoCAD, as well as knowledge of BIM standards and project collaboration tools, is typically required. Exceptional attention to detail, time management, and effective remote communication are vital soft skills for success in this role. These abilities ensure high-quality, accurate modeling deliverables and seamless collaboration with project teams, crucial for meeting project deadlines and standards in a remote setting.

How does collaboration typically work for a remote structural BIM modeler working as an independent contractor?

As a remote Structural BIM Modeler working independently, you'll regularly collaborate with project managers, engineers, and other BIM professionals through online platforms and cloud-based BIM software. Communication is often conducted via video calls, emails, and project management tools to review designs, coordinate changes, and resolve issues. Staying organized and proactive with updates is key, as you'll be responsible for meeting deadlines and ensuring your models align with project specifications. While you have autonomy over your schedule, effective teamwork and clear documentation are essential to successfully integrate your work with the broader project team.

Structural Designer – Timber & Wood Framing


3D Structural Modeling | Revit / Cadwork | Fabrication & Construction


About the Role

DC Structures is looking for a Structural Designer to join our design and fabrication team.

This is not simply a drafting position.

Our Structural Designers virtually build our structures in 3D before they are fabricated and constructed in the field.

Working from architectural plans, structural engineering requirements, and project specifications, you will develop detailed 3D models of the complete structural framing system using Revit and/or Cadwork.

You will model and detail the structural components that make up our buildings—including wall framing, floor systems, roof systems, beams, posts, heavy timber, connections, openings, and other structural elements. Your work becomes the bridge between architecture, engineering, fabrication, and construction.


What You'll Do

Structural Modeling & Design

  • Develop detailed 3D structural models using Revit and/or Cadwork
  • Model complete wood-framed and heavy timber building systems
  • Develop framing layouts for walls, floors, roofs, beams, posts, and timber systems
  • Translate architectural drawings and structural engineering requirements into coordinated, buildable structural models
  • Determine how structural components come together and identify potential conflicts before they reach the field
  • Incorporate engineering requirements, details, connections, and revisions into the structural model
  • Coordinate architectural, structural, and fabrication requirements within the model
  • Review your work for accuracy, constructability, efficiency, and completeness


Construction Documents & Shop Drawings

Turn the structural model into the information our fabrication and construction teams need to build the project.

You will:

  • Produce detailed structural drawings
  • Develop framing plans and details
  • Create shop and fabrication drawings
  • Produce cut sheets and component drawings
  • Create detailed material and component takeoffs
  • Develop drawings for engineering and client review
  • Incorporate engineering and project revisions into final construction documents
  • Help create accurate information for prefabrication and field installation


Fabrication & Prefabrication

DC Structures prefabricates significant portions of our structural building packages before they arrive at the jobsite.

Our Structural Designers play a critical role in making that possible.

You will work closely with our fabrication and operations teams to ensure that what is modeled on the computer can be accurately fabricated, packaged, delivered, and assembled in the field.

The Type of Projects You'll Work On

DC Structures specializes in highly customized wood-framed and heavy timber buildings throughout the United States.

Projects include:

  • Luxury custom homes
  • Heavy timber residences
  • Barn homes
  • Equestrian facilities
  • Wedding and event venues
  • Wineries and tasting rooms
  • Commercial buildings
  • Mixed-use structures
  • Large custom timber structures


Many of our projects combine conventional wood framing with heavy timber, engineered wood products, complex roof systems, large spans, custom connections, and prefabricated components.

Every project is different.
